This is an Invitation for Bid (IFB) for the installation of electric service to 16 campsites at Beall Woods State Park. This procurement is exclusively for small business set-aside program vendors. A non-mandatory presubmission conference will be held on May 8, 2026, at 1:00 p. m. at the Beall Woods State Park. Vendors must upload a signed contract, a completed offer to the state of Illinois with an authorized signature, and a vendor disclosure or IPG active registered vendor disclosure. Failure to complete and upload these documents will result in disqualification.

The Illinois Department of Natural Resources, Office of Land Management, is seeking to procure a turbo-charged 85 PTO HP low profile utility tractor for the James C. Helfrich Game Propagation Center. Interested parties can find detailed specifications in the attached documents. The bid opening date is April 28, 2026. Electronic quotes are allowed.
The required date for this procurement is July 1, 2026.

This is a notice of an emergency contract extension for vault toilet replacement services at the sailboat harbor boat ramp within the Wayne Fitzgerrell State Recreation Area in Whittington, Illinois. It is not a solicitation for new services. The extension is for time only. The contact for information is Kara Glaub at ***@***. *. * or ****.
